What does a trainee insurance estimator do?

A Trainee Insurance Estimator assists in evaluating damage to property, vehicles, or other insured items to determine the cost of repairs or replacements. They work under the supervision of experienced estimators, learning how to inspect damages, gather information, and prepare reports for insurance claims. Their role is essential in ensuring that insurance claims are processed accurately and fairly. Training typically involves both classroom learning and on-the-job experience, gradually building their expertise in assessment and customer service.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a trainee insurance estimator?

To thrive as a Trainee Insurance Estimator,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of insurance principles, usually sup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with estimating software such as Xactimate and basic proficiency in Microsoft Office are commonly required, and some entry-level certifications in insurance or estimating can be beneficial. Excellent communication, critical thinking, and organizational skills help you coordinate with clients, colleagues, and vendors effectively. These abilities are essential for producing accurate estimates, ensuring customer satisfaction, and supporting the claims process efficiently.

What are some common challenges faced by a trainee insurance estimator, and how can they be addressed?

As a Trainee Insurance Estimator, one common challenge is accurately assessing the extent of damage and determining fair repair costs, especially when new to interpreting technical reports or policy details. It's also common to feel overwhelmed by the need to balance customer expectations with company guidelines. These challenges can be addressed by seeking mentorship from experienced colleagues, participating in ongoing training, and familiarizing yourself with industry-standard estimating software. Open communication with team members and adjusters also helps streamline the learning process and ensures consistent, fair outcomes.

What is the difference between Trainee Insurance Estimator vs Insurance Estimator?

AspectTrainee Insurance EstimatorInsurance Estimator
CredentialsEntry-level, often requires a high school diploma or equivalent; some industry-specific trainingTypically requires relevant certifications or licenses, such as state-specific insurance licenses
Work EnvironmentOn-the-job training, supervised environment, office settingIndependent or team-based work, office or field environment
ResponsibilitiesAssisting with estimating insurance claims, learning industry proceduresPreparing detailed insurance estimates, assessing damages, communicating with clients and adjusters

The main difference between a Trainee Insurance Estimator and an Insurance Estimator is experience and responsibility level. Trainees are in learning phases, focusing on gaining skills and understanding industry processes, while Insurance Estimators are fully responsible for preparing accurate estimates and managing claims independently.

Auto-Owners Insurance, a top-rated insurance carrier, is seeking a motivated claims trainee to join our team. This job handles entry-level insurance claims under close supervision through the life-cycle of a claim including but not limited to: investigation, evaluation, and claim resolution. This job provides service to agents, insureds, and others to ensure claims resolve accurately and timely. This job includes training and development completion of the Company's claims training program for the assigned line of insurance and requires the person to:

  • Investigate, evaluate, and settle entry-level insurance claims
  • Study insurance policies, endorsements, and forms to develop foundational knowledge on Company insurance products
  • Learn and comply with Company claim handling procedures
  • Develop entry-level claim negotiation and settlement skills
  • Build skills to effectively serve the needs of agents, insureds, and others
  • Meet and communicate with claimants, legal counsel, and third-parties
  • Develop specialized skills including but not limited to, estimating and use of designated computer-based programs for loss adjustment
  • Study, obtain, and maintain an adjuster's license(s), if required by statute within the timeline established by the Company or legal requirements
